Works

Minister: Dave Umahi

Mandate

The Federal Ministry of Works plans, constructs and maintains federal highways and bridges, sets engineering standards, and supervises major civil works that connect states and key economic corridors.

It supervises the Federal Roads Maintenance Agency (FERMA), the Council for the Regulation of Engineering in Nigeria (COREN) interface, the Nigerian Building and Road Research Institute, and federal highway zones across the country. It also administers the Highway Manual and Procurement of Engineering Services regulations.

Current priorities include the Lagos–Calabar Coastal Highway, the Sokoto–Badagry Super Highway, the Second Niger Bridge access roads, rehabilitation of the Lagos–Ibadan and Abuja–Kano expressways, expanded use of concrete pavement on critical corridors, the Highway Development and Management Initiative for tolling and maintenance concessions, and tighter axle-load enforcement to extend road life.
